阿里云服务器会超时
阿里云服务器会超时?原因可能是这些!
在数字化服务高速发展的今天,云服务器的稳定性直接关系到企业业务的运行效率。当用户反馈"阿里云服务器会超时"时,往往伴随着对业务中断、数据延迟的担忧。这种现象可能源于多种技术因素,也需要结合实际应用策略来系统化应对。本文将从多维度解析超时问题的发生机制,并提供切实可行的解决方案。
一、服务器超时问题的常见表现形式
云服务器超时故障主要表现为访问延迟、接口无响应、任务执行中断等场景。以电商系统为例,当用户下单请求提交后遭遇服务器无反馈,可能是后端API接口处理超时导致的。类似地,高并发下的支付网关服务中断,往往与服务器资源分配不足相关。这类问题在直播平台临时流量激增、教育行业考试系统座位分配等场景中尤为突出。
场景化分析显示,超时故障具有三大特征:
- 突发性:通常发生在业务高峰期或系统升级后
- 时段性:网络层问题常出现在凌晨低峰维护时段
- 扩散性:初始小范围故障可能引发链式反应
二、资源配给失衡的深层原因
1. 系统负载与业务需求的错配
多数超时事故源于资源配置的深层矛盾。当服务器的CPU、内存使用率长期维持在90%以上时,新增的并发请求容易形成等待队列。这种情况在中小型企业的虚拟私有云实例中尤为常见,运维人员往往通过临时扩容解决,但未建立动态调整机制。
2. 网络传输的不确定性
云服务器的网络架构涉及多层转发,从本地数据中心到服务器节点需经过路由交换。研究表明,网络延迟超过500ms的通病出现在:
- 本地访问链路波动
- 云节点到业务节点传输路径拥塞
- 跨区域部署时回包确认超窗
3. 存储I/O性能的瓶颈
高速存储与海量数据需求的冲突成为超时新诱因。传统机械硬盘在每秒2000次随机读写后会出现明显延迟,而SSD存储虽吞吐量提升显著,但全闪存架构下的GC(垃圾回收)机制也存在性能损耗窗口。
三、代码逻辑设计引发的超时陷阱
程序层面的设计缺陷常是被忽视的主因。典型的架构问题包括:
- 阻塞式调用:数据库查询未设置超时限制,导致请求线程僵死
- 循环嵌套过深:非分页处理方案在大数据量时形成计算黑洞
- 锁机制滥用:内存资源竞争引发的死锁状态造成处理队列停滞
某视频制作公司的实际案例显示,其渲染程序在未配置合理超时策略下,单帧处理超时导致整条流水线瘫痪。优化后通过强中断机制重启失败流程,使超时故障率下降83%。
四、弹性扩容的正确打开方式
阿里云生态中,弹性计算家族提供了多个解决方案类型:
- 计算巢服务(Compute Gallery)实现无人工参与的自动扩容
- 弹性伸缩(Auto Scaling)根据监控指标设定智能扩容阈值
- 弹性分布式云节点(EDC)的细粒度资源分配能力
在金融行业的交易所撮合系统测试中,通过弹性伸缩功能动态增加从32核到256核的计算能力,峰值期间成交确认响应时间从12秒降至1.5秒。但需注意,扩容策略需与过载保护机制结合设计,避免过度扩容导致资源空转。
五、构建超时预防体系的技术路径
1. 分层式响应架构
采用分层预警机制能有效遏制超时扩散:当CPU使用率超过70%时发送黄灯预警,内存泄露达15%启动缓存清理,网络等待时间超过200ms自动切换镜像节点。这种分层次响应策略使处理效率提升40%。
2. 智能化监控网络
组建由Fluentd+Flowgger+logstack构成的立体监控体系,实时捕获关键业务指标。重点监测TCP连接的SYN重传率、HTTP请求超时分布、应用层响应耗时等参数。管理员发现,单节点的最大连接数超出预设阈值34%后,超时集中出现。
3. 分布式缓存优化
通过memcached/distributed cache集群降低数据库直连次:将热点数据缓存命中率提到98%,使原超时占比1.2%的查询接口故障率归零。部署时注意二级缓存的过期时间分层策略。
六、应急处理与长期优化策略
即时响应方案包含:
- 启用抢占式实例平衡资源分配
- 使用ims/kernel模块对内核级服务进行优先级调度
- 配置failover的主备实例自动切换
系统性优化建议则要完成:
- 建立基线指标监控系统(建立14天以上的历史性能基准)
- 开展每年不少于2次的极限压力测试
- 在业务表单提交等关键路径部署熔断机制
- 使用分片存储应对PB级数据读写
- 对HTML静态资源实施边缘节点预加载
某教育机构在考试系统优化中,通过压力测试发现32核实例不足处理突发流量。最终采用128核弹性扩容+负载均衡+CDN组合方案,在2024年秋季考试期间实现百万级考生零超时接入。
七、预算管理的攻防平衡
资源过度配置可能带来隐性成本:某医药公司的云服务年投入随着扩容增加从200万跃升至450万,但实际业务峰值只出现在特定季度。通过计算出各业务模块适用的规格组合,采用计费周期弹性切换的策略,使其年度费用降低121万。
建议企业制定动态资源配置的经济效益模型:
- 计算不可用成本(含客户投诉损失、业务停滞等)
- 比较预分配资源成本
- 确定最优弹性比例(通常维持在峰值需求40%左右)
八、未来基础设施的发展方向
随着IPv6普及和量子通信技术进步,超时问题将呈现新特征。2025年应用架构趋势显示,第三代可重构计算巢的部署使故障隔离能力提升90%。此外,利用5G切片网络进行业务分流,可降低跨境服务延迟37%。建议企业及时更新架构设计文档,将现有单体系统拆分为微服务架构,采用毫秒级实时镜像策略。
九、用户自检装置核查清单
当遭遇超时时段,建议按照以下步骤排查:
- 通过运维总览查询资源动态(5分钟和60分钟的资源趋势图)
- 在应用程序日志中筛查人工阻塞痕迹
- 检查web config、mysql等关键服务配置
- 运行pod login排查容器内部异常
- 对照网卡性能指标判断是否达上限
- 审查时钟同步配置(NTP时间偏移超过30秒立即同步)
十、结语:构建服务韧性新范式
云服务器超时问题本质是数字时代资源配置的动态平衡挑战。通过合理运用预分配、真空路由、进程隔离等技术,配合业务数据链路的缓释设计,可将服务中断概率压制在0.001%以下。建议企业每季度进行一次应急预案推演,将历史故障数据转化为优化参数,让技术进化成为业务发展的重要支撑。在经历2023到2024年的转型期后,成熟的云运维体系将帮助更多企业实现"系统零感知核心网络故障"的管理目标。